Censor 2021

As a vigilant film censor, Enid meticulously guards audiences from the horrors of violence and gore. But beneath her duty lies a deep-seated guilt over her sister's mysterious disappearance, now declared dead. When an eerie film sparks familiar childhood memories, Enid's investigation unravels dark secrets tied to her own troubled past.
